About Eureka Tower

Named after The Eureka Stockade, the 1854 rebellion of prospectors in the Victorian goldfields, the Eureka Tower stands 91 stories above the ground in the heart of Southbank. The skyscraper's gold crown and gold-plated windows add to the theme and literally sparkle when the sun catches the top of the building. Skydeck located on the 88th floor affords the highest public view in the Southern Hemisphere. One of the unique experiences is The Edge, a glass cube that slides out three meters from the building for vertigo-free visitors. Get a panoramic view of Melbourne City from around 300 meters above sea level. There are almost 30 viewfinders on the Skydeck through which you can spot some of the major landmarks of Melbourne from the towering heights of the Eureka. This is the only place in the world where you will find “The Edge” – a glass cube located at the 88th floor of the tower, providing incredible views to tourists who are suspended from here.
